Output 8ca570827acc6ec706ca91f3664c440a17f4f0cd0b5d1376065608d4d383dd03:1

value
30866832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5386db4eb0f0bf6a63d2093577ad828dc6b59f34 OP_EQUALVERIFY OP_CHECKSIG
address
18cedvoQVCoeuf2iPD99tXsBfFvztF4kHp
transaction
8ca570827acc6ec706ca91f3664c440a17f4f0cd0b5d1376065608d4d383dd03
spent
true